Hostal Pilcar is a restaurant in Tarancón, Cuenca, Castile-La Mancha which is located on Avenida de Adolfo Suárez. Hostal Pilcar is situated nearby to the community center Centro social de Tarancón, as well as near the police station Guardia Civil.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Fuente de Pedro Naharro is a municipality in Cuenca, Castile-La Mancha, Spain. It has a population of 1,211. Fuente de Pedro Naharro is situated 9 km south of Hostal Pilcar.

Tribaldos is a municipality in Cuenca province, Castile-La Mancha, Spain. According to the 2004 census, the municipality has a population of 129 residents. Tribaldos is situated 9 km east of Hostal Pilcar.
